Before it teaches anything, one document in the Hanumanic Strategy corpus stops and builds a floor. Four named conditions, stated in full before the first practice is described, governing whether the material that follows may be used at all.1
⚑⚑ This is the best thing the corpus does, and the build has been recording for four phases that the corpus does not do it. ⚠ The finding that the extension corpus goes looking for permission and not for limits is well established and correct about most of it.5 This document is the counter-example, and it is worth as much as the finding.
Integration with Existing Care. "Every practice suggested in this system should be discussed with your therapist to ensure compatibility with your current treatment approach." The framing is explicit: spiritual method supports rather than competes with evidence-based intervention, and the reader is told to think of the material as "adding spiritual understanding to your existing toolkit rather than replacing professional care."1
Grounding and Reality Testing. A stated criterion — authentic development "always enhances rather than compromises practical functioning and clear thinking" — and a stated consequence: "any practice that increases confusion, isolation, or disconnection from supportive relationships should be modified or discontinued."1
Graduated Approach. Basic understanding and gentle practice first; advancement only when foundation skills are solid and mental health remains stable.1 ⚑ Two conditions, and the second is not about the practice at all.
Warning Sign Recognition. Four named indicators — increased anxiety, sleep disruption, difficulty concentrating, and any symptom that concerns either the practitioner or their therapist.1
⚑ The obvious reading is that this is a disclaimer, and the obvious reading is wrong.
⚠ The taxonomy the document goes on to teach cannot be applied without an outside view, and not as a matter of caution — as a matter of logic.6 Each of its five obstacle patterns is defined as a misapplication of a capacity: energy without direction, rest that became stuck, discrimination that became refusal. ⚑⚑ So the classification is never readable from the behaviour alone. Restless energy is agitation or it is appropriate urgency. Withdrawal is inertia or it is the protective response the document itself insists on respecting.
⚑ The diagnosis depends on whether the circumstances warranted the response — which is precisely the judgement a person inside a strong affective state cannot make about themselves. ⚠ The therapist is not there in case something goes wrong. The instrument does not function without one.

One line does more work than the four conditions together.
"The traditional approach values practical effectiveness over spiritual intensity, so modifying practices to maintain wellbeing aligns perfectly with authentic spiritual development."1
⚑⚑ This makes reducing practice a mark of fidelity rather than of failure, which removes the single mechanism by which a person in difficulty is most reliably kept in it. ⚠ The ordinary structure of an intensive practice makes cutting back an admission — of weakness, of insufficient sincerity, of not really wanting it. A framework that reverses the sign has done something no amount of listed contraindications achieves.

The framework's structural achievement is where it sits.
⚑ It is the fourth section of the document, before the first classification and before any practice. ⚠ Every other cautionary passage in the corpus read to date arrives at the end of a document, in a closing note, or as a bracketed aside inside a protocol.
⚑⚑ A caution at the end is read by someone who has already decided to try the thing. A precondition at the front is read by someone deciding. ⚠ The difference is not emphasis; it is which question the reader is holding when they meet the text.

⚑ The framework assumes the practitioner will notice the warning signs, and three of the four are conditions that impair noticing.
⚠ Increased anxiety, sleep disruption, difficulty concentrating. ⚑⚑ A person losing sleep and unable to concentrate is not well placed to run a periodic self-audit for lost sleep and poor concentration. The fourth sign — any symptom that concerns you or your therapist — is the only one that routes outward, and it is listed last and phrased as an afterthought.
🧭 The open question is what a warning system looks like when it cannot rely on the person it protects. ⚑ The tradition's answer is structural rather than perceptual — a teacher who sees you at intervals, a community that notices absence, a calendar that interrupts practice whether or not you feel it needs interrupting. ⚠ None of those requires the practitioner to detect anything.
